Lesson Overview
ChatGPT is an AI tool created by OpenAI that’s designed to respond to prompts and chat in a conversational way. You can type questions, ideas, or tasks into a chat window and get back instant responses that are clear and often surprisingly helpful. ChatGPT stands out because it isn’t just a search engine; you can ask for rewrites, more examples, or different approaches, making your interaction feel natural and productive as you clarify your needs.
For business owners and entrepreneurs, ChatGPT can take on routine but time-consuming tasks. Examples include drafting emails, summarizing content, brainstorming marketing ideas, or helping to organize your workflow. These features can free up your time and help you generate new ideas or complete repetitive business work more quickly.
This lesson also introduces you to the different versions of ChatGPT—from the free plan to paid subscriptions—and briefly touches on other AI tools like Claude, Gemini, and Perplexity. While each of these platforms has its own features, ChatGPT is often the best starting point for small businesses due to its simplicity and broad capabilities. Understanding your options and how ChatGPT fits into common business tasks will help you decide the right tools for your needs.

Technical & Workflow Benefits
Using ChatGPT for everyday business activities gives you faster results compared to handling things manually. For example, rather than spending 20 minutes trying to write a customer response from scratch, you can get a solid draft in seconds and simply tweak it to match your style. The basic (free) version supports a wide range of tasks, and upgrading unlocks even more features with higher daily limits—avoiding interruptions during busy workdays.
With AI, brainstorming sessions speed up, content output increases, and you can automate routine emails or plans with more consistency. Compared to juggling multiple AI tools, starting with ChatGPT gives you one simple place for writing, research, and even image generation. If your business grows or your needs become more advanced, knowing about alternative tools like Claude or Gemini helps you expand without switching your workflow. For most users, ChatGPT’s ease of use and flexibility deliver clear time savings and better work quality.
Practice Exercise
Try opening a ChatGPT account, or log in if you already have one, and test its core functionality by setting up a simple business task:
- Go to chatgpt.com and sign up with your email or a Google/Microsoft/Apple account.
- Once inside, type a prompt such as, “Write a short follow-up email to a customer who made a recent purchase.”
- Review and edit the response to fit your business’s tone or style.
Reflection: How quickly did you get a usable draft compared to writing it manually? What would improve the output, such as being more detailed in your prompt?
